Home ::The Windsor Ballrooms Is An Event Venue For Corporates In Montreal
The Windsor Ballrooms Is An Event Venue For Corporates In Montreal
Description: Host your upcoming Montreal corporate meeting or event at The Windsor Ballrooms.It’s newly renovated rooms are available for corporate parties, weddings, fundraisers, outdoor functions, business dinners, and other events in Montreal.
contact us
Address: 1170 Rue Peel #110,Montréal,Québec,Canada,H3B 0A9